Spire and Gravity Supply Chain solutions helping restore flow of goods

Gravity Supply Chain

The quantity of goods carried by containers soared from 102 million metric tons in 1980 to about 1.83 billion metric tons as of 2017. manufacturers have increasingly relied on parts produced in low-cost countries, especially China, a practice known as offshoring.
